ORDER

The Government of Telangana vide their letter No. 08/SC-A/A3/2013 dated 15.9.2014 have requested for fixation of seniority/year of allotment of officers of undivided Andhra Pradesh, who were appointed to IAS by promotion (against SCS quota vacancies) on basis of Select List of 2013 vide DoPT’s notification No. 14015/01/2012-AIS-I dated 7.2.2013. The same has been considered and computed under Rule 3(3) (ii) of IAS (Regulation of Seniority), Rules 1987 and other relevant Rules as amended from time to time. As per relevant rules weightage formula works out:-

Completed years of qualifying service Weightage in years
12 3
15 4
18 5
21 6
23 7
25 8
27 9(Maximum)

2.1 As per Rule 4 of the IAS (Regulation of Seniority) Rules, 1987, the officer whose name has been mentioned at SI. No. 1 of the select list of 2012 shall be placed below Shri K. Surendra Mohan, junior most promotee IAS officer of 2007 batch of undivided Andhra Pradesh cadre. 2.2 As per Rule 4 of the IAS (Regulation of Seniority) Rules, 1987, the officer whose name has been mentioned at SI. No. 2 to 4 of the select list of 2012 shall be placed below Shri Vinay Chandra, junior most RR IAS officer of 2008 batch and above Shri Hari Kiran Chevvuru, senior most RR IAS officer of batch 2009 batch of undivided Andhra Pradesh cadre. 3.
